USA manager Jurgen Klinsmann:
"Tim Howard played phenomenal. He was outstanding and he kept us in the game. We knew we would have chances if we kept going forward but he was absolutely amazing.
"You can give him the biggest compliments in the world.
"The longer he keeps you in the game you hope that you will get the breaks going forward. You can build on the back of Tim. Games are decided by little things and thanks to Tim we had that possibility throughout 120 minutes."

BBC Sport's Ben Smith in Brazil
"I am not sure there are any words to describe the second half of extra time. I will admit it, I had written the USA off. Completely. They looked dead on their feet. They look beaten. Totally.
"How they did what they did in the final 10 minutes is beyond me, but they made this yet another wonderful match in what is a tournament that continues to thrill, delight and surprise.
"Belgium were better, but as the US players leave the field beneath me they do so with huge credit. More please."

We now have the full line-up of quarter finals then.
Brazil v Colombia, Friday 4 July 21:00 BST
France v Germany, Friday July 4 17:00 BST
Netherlands v Costa Rica, Saturday 5 July 21:00 BST
Argentina v Belgium, Saturday 5 July 17:00 BST
